Iran is reportedly providing to promote superior weapons techniques together with ballistic missiles, drones and warships to international governments for cryptocurrency, as Tehran seems to be for brand new fee rails that may slip previous Western monetary controls.
The Monetary Instances reported that Iran’s Ministry of Defence Export Heart, generally known as Mindex, is pitching offers that settle for digital currencies, whereas additionally permitting barter preparations and funds in Iranian rials.
The provide emerged over the previous yr and seems to be one of many first identified circumstances of a nation-state publicly signalling it is going to take crypto for strategic army exports.

Mindex says it has consumer relationships with 35 international locations, and it markets a listing that features Emad ballistic missiles, Shahed drones, Shahid Soleimani-class warships and short-range air defence techniques, in keeping with the report.
Its multilingual web site additionally lists small arms, rockets and anti-ship cruise missiles, a few of which Western governments and UN reporting have linked to Iran-backed militant teams within the Center East, the FT stated.
On the location, Mindex says consumers should conform to circumstances about how weapons could be used “throughout a conflict with one other nation”, though it provides such phrases are “negotiable between the contracting events”.
The export centre additionally operates a web-based portal and a digital chatbot, which guides potential prospects by way of the method and addresses considerations about sanctions in an FAQ.

The positioning doesn’t listing costs, but it surely mentions consumers can prepare fee within the vacation spot nation and it provides in-person inspection of products in Iran, topic to approval from safety authorities, in keeping with the newspaper.
The pitch lands at a second when crypto has turn out to be a sensible software for sanctioned actors making an attempt to maintain commerce transferring, and US and European officers have stepped up enforcement towards networks that use different channels to route cash across the formal banking system.
In Sept. 2025, the US Treasury introduced sanctions concentrating on a monetary community it stated supported Iran’s army, and it alleged using shadow banking constructions that may embrace crypto-linked schemes and abroad fronts.

For counterparties, the dangers stay excessive, anybody utilizing standard finance to pay Iran can face restrictions below US and allied sanctions programmes, which might lower entry to Western-linked banking and commerce companies.
Iran’s arms advertising and marketing additionally comes as the worldwide weapons commerce reshapes below the pressure of the Ukraine conflict. SIPRI has reported that Russia’s arms exports fell 64% between 2015 to 2019 and 2020 to 2024, and the FT stated Iran ranked 18th on this planet for main arms exports in 2024, whereas noting that Russia’s diminished capability has opened house for different suppliers.
The Atlantic Council argued in 2024 that Iran was on monitor to switch Russia as a number one arms exporter and stated Washington wants a technique to counter that pattern.
